Features

  • Brushless motor: The brushless motor in the Metabo PowerMaxx BS 12 BL Q provides optimal power and runtime. Brushless motors are more efficient than brushed motors, which means that they can run for longer on a single battery charge. They are also less likely to overheat and wear out, which means that they have a longer lifespan.
